Title: SAINT MARY, WHITECHAPEL: WHITECHAPEL HIGH STREET, TOWER HAMLETS. Description: Parish registers & administrative records. COVERING DATES OF REGISTERS DEPOSITED. November 1558 - August 1940 Baptisms. December 1558 - November 1940 Marriages. November 1558 - June 1857 Burials.

The London Borough of Tower Hamlets is a London borough covering much of the traditional East End. It was formed in 1965 from the merger of the former metropolitan boroughs of Stepney, Poplar, and Bethnal Green.
